Iron dyshomeostasis has been associated previously with aging and aging-related diseases. In this work, we find that loss of Shawn results in an increased free Fe 2+ pool in mitochondria (Fig. 7). Although free iron is potentially not harmful, it can become redox active and highly toxic in combination with increased levels of H2O2 (Sohal et al., 1999; Kakhlon and Cabantchik, 2002; Doulias et al., 2008). Under these circumstances, a minimal free iron pool is sufficient to result in cytotoxicity (Xu et al., 2010). The change in mitochondrial redox status in shawn mutants may turn this iron pool in a highly redox-active one. This in turn may lead to increased oxidative stress, mitochondrial dysfunction, and neuronal dysfunction and death.
